Figure 1. RIP-Chip analysis of the hnRNP-A1–, hnRNP-E2–, hnRNP-K–, and La/SSB-associated mRNAs in CML-BC–derived Ph1+ K562 cells. Left column: Venn diagram of the RNAs associated with (A) hnRNP-A1, (B) hnRNP-E2, (C) hnRNP-K, and (D) La/SSB within the cytoplasm of Ph1+ K562 cells. The squares depict the genes available on the indicated Affymetrix chips. The gray ellipses represent the genes detected in lysate input. The white ellipses indicate the genes significantly enriched in the hnRNP-A1, hnRNP-E2, hnRNP-K, and La/SSB immunoprecipitates and not present in immunoprecipitates with a nonrelated antibody. Right column: tables show the hnRNP-A1–, hnRNP-E2–, hnRNP-K–, and La-associated mRNAs with a reported relevance in cancer. mRNAs are represented as fold increase versus negative control (anti-Flag or anti-HA) and fold increase versus total input RNA.
